About MCC USB-1608G Series
The MCC USB-1608G Series is a family of high-speed multifunction USB data acquisition devices offering 16 single-ended or 8 differential analog inputs at 16-bit resolution with up to 500 kS/s aggregate sample rate. The series spans the USB-1608G (250 kS/s) and USB-1608GX (500 kS/s) base models, plus the USB-1608G-2AO and USB-1608GX-2AO variants that add two 16-bit analog outputs. Every model provides 8 digital I/O lines and a 32-bit counter — delivering comprehensive measurement and control capability in a USB 2.0 bus-powered package. Analog outputs are available only on the -2AO models; the base USB-1608G and USB-1608GX have no analog outputs.
USB-1608G Series Specifications
| Feature | USB-1608G | USB-1608GX | -2AO models |
|---|---|---|---|
| Analog Inputs | 16 SE / 8 DIFF | 16 SE / 8 DIFF | 16 SE / 8 DIFF |
| ADC Resolution | 16-bit | 16-bit | 16-bit |
| Max Sample Rate | 250 kS/s | 500 kS/s | 250 / 500 kS/s |
| Input Ranges | +/-10V, +/-5V, +/-2V, +/-1V | +/-10V, +/-5V, +/-2V, +/-1V | +/-10V, +/-5V, +/-2V, +/-1V |
| Analog Outputs | none | none | 2 x 16-bit, +/-10 V fixed, 250 kS/s/ch |
| Digital I/O | 8 channels | 8 channels | 8 channels |
| Counter | 1 x 32-bit | 1 x 32-bit | 1 x 32-bit |
| Interface | USB 2.0 | USB 2.0 | USB 2.0 |
Multiple software-selectable input ranges (+/-10 V, +/-5 V, +/-2 V, +/-1 V) maximize ADC resolution for each measurement scenario. Analog outputs are available only on the USB-1608G-2AO and USB-1608GX-2AO models, two 16-bit channels at 250 kS/s/ch (500 kS/s single channel), fixed +/-10 V range. MCC Universal Library provides drivers for Python, MATLAB, LabVIEW, C/C++, and .NET.
